- About a quarter of a mile from my home is a garden called Charley's garden. I often wondered why it was called such a name. Long ago there was a man his wife and one daughter was living in a hut near a mountain. They were very poor and they descided on saving money and emigrating to America. The fare was not much to America then and in the course of a year they had enough saved and they went. Their daughter Eden was three years when they landed in America. When she grew older she went to high school and she got a good education. She was to be a teacher but when she was sixteen years of age her father died and therefore she had to stay with her mother who was fifty years of age. The woman had a good pay and having only the one daughter she banked the most of it for her. When the woman was fifty two years she died leaving all her money to her daughter. After a year or so the girl came home to her uncle's and stayed there until there was a new house built for her.
